He married Ormanda Elizabeth Bartlett 31 Jan 1858 in Watervliet, Berrien, Michigan. They settled in Van Buren, Michigan. From 1875-1879 they were living at Fort Collins, CO. In 1880 they were back in Van Buren, MI
Children:
1. William Thomas "Willie"
2. Lola Emeline
3. Arabelle Loolie "Belle"
4. Elina Ninetta "Nettie" "Ninettie"
5. Ella Almeda "Ellie"
6. Nelie Sefena "Nellie" "Nella"
7. Josephine Elizabeth "Josie"
Military:
13 Aug 1862 enlisted into the Union Army as a Private.
5 Sep 1862 enlisted into the Nineteenth Michigan Inf, Co. G.
5 Mar 1863 captured at Thompson's Station, TN
22 Mar 1863 confined in Richmond, VA
31 Mar 1863 paroled and sent to Ohio
6 Apr 1863 he was at Camp Chase, OH
10 Jun 1865 mustered out of the army.
2 Oct 1884 filed for pension as an invalid
Later Life:
From 1901 to his death in 1911, he was living in the Michigan Soldiers' Home, Grand Rapids, Kent, MI
